ABSOLUT E MAX IMUM RAT INGS
Input Supply Voltage (Pin 1) . . . . . . . . . . . . . . 16 V to –0.3 V
Continuous Output Current (Pin 8) . . . . . . . . . . . . . . 50 mA
Sense Voltages (Pins 4, 5) . . . . . . . . . . . . . . . . 10 V to –0.3 V
Operating Ambient T emperature Range . . . . . 0
°
C to +70
°
C
Extended Commercial T emperature Range . . –40
°
C to +85
°
C
Junction T emperature* . . . . . . . . . . . . . . . . . . . . . . . +150
°
C
Storage T emperature Range . . . . . . . . . . . . –65
°
C to +150
°
C
Lead T emperature (Soldering, 10 sec) . . . . . . . . . . . +300
°
C
